Comprehensive side-by-side LLM comparison
GPT-4 leads with 9.5% higher average benchmark score. Llama 3.1 8B Instruct offers 196.6K more tokens in context window than GPT-4. Llama 3.1 8B Instruct is $89.94 cheaper per million tokens. GPT-4 supports multimodal inputs. Llama 3.1 8B Instruct is available on 9 providers. Overall, GPT-4 is the stronger choice for coding tasks.
OpenAI
GPT-4 was created as a large multimodal model capable of accepting image and text inputs while producing text outputs. Developed to exhibit human-level performance on various professional and academic benchmarks, it marked a significant advancement in reliability, creativity, and handling of nuanced instructions compared to its predecessors.
Meta
Llama 3.1 8B was developed as an efficient open-source model, designed to bring capable instruction-following to applications with limited computational resources. Built with 8 billion parameters, it provides a lightweight option for developers seeking reliable performance without the overhead of larger models.
